We are applying as a couple. My wife has completed her Bachelors and Masters degrees and she has her WES evaluation for both degrees. I am the secondary applicant and I did my Bachelors from India and Masters from USA and I only have WES evaluation for the highest level degree. While creating the profile I have mentioned both degrees but for Batchelors degree I have mentioned that I do not have evaluation for it and everything is good for Masters degree. I ended up getting 10 points for education which would have been the same even if I had evaluation for Batchelors degree.

So in short my WES report is only for Masters degree. I do have mark sheets and diploma for Batchelors degree which I am going to upload anyways. points are awarded for the highest degree and you have provided ECA for that.. it is ok to provide info on bachelors but ECA is not required..
your education assessment agency should have asked for both when evaluating masters.. since they did not asked for it.. you are fine..
